i'm sorry to see that.some people's kids.i've never used any of those products but i work in a bodyshop and the old rule of thumb is,if the scratch catches your fingernail as you drag it across it,it won't completely come out.it's to bad your not closer i'd try and buff it out for ya.read up on what the guy's on here are saying about those products.we get people dropping by asking to see if scratches will come out some times.when you get your new ride on the road see if a place near you will give it a try may have some luck.

I feel your pain and wish I could offer you a positive solution, but since the scratch looks white, it has likely gone through the color. The scratch remover stuff on TV used to contain a dye. I don't know if that is true with the newer stuff.

I would reccomend you go to a good body shop and have them tackle the job. Ive had some luck with a good wetsanding then polishing compound but if youve never done it yourself I wouldnt try, its best left to the pros.
